			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>A four-section silver plate and mirrored glass table plateau.  French, c. 1789, with two D-ended sections and two square sections, all with a cast column and swag gallery, the sections containing mirrored glass with original wood base, unmarked.  An identical plateau was purchased by George Washington while president and then moved it to Mount Vernon, where it is in the collection today.  See Cadou, The George Washington Collection, 140-141.  Plating worn off in general, otherwise in very good condition. 59 ¾ l. x 20 5/8&nbsp;w.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>A George III mahogany tester bedstead, second half 18th century, having finely carved fluted columnar leaf-capped front posts on square-section legs with molded plinth feet. Rear posts are plain, and tapered, having a rectangular slide-in headboard. This bed was originally in Michie Tavern, Charlottesville. Includes custom box spring insert and fine custom made toile bed hangings.  Will fit a contemporary double (full)&nbsp;mattress.</p>
